Research & Development – Foundations for Innovation and Safety

We often become aware of our expectations for everyday products only when they are not met. The cause is frequently found in the design or in the material used, which failed to withstand the mechanical demands of real-life application. The result is a damaged component and a disappointed user expectation. The stakes are even higher when the mechanical strength of a part is crucial for the safety of people, animals, or the environment.

At TesT, we are committed to making a meaningful contribution in this field. With advanced measuring and testing technology, we enable the research and development of mechanical properties of a wide range of materials – from pure metals such as aluminum to alloys like steel. Our material testing machines play a key role in alloy and material development. They determine critical parameters such as tensile strength, yield point, elongation at break, and hardness – essential for evaluating the suitability of new materials for specific applications. For example, the properties of steel can be purposefully optimized through systematic testing of different alloy compositions – for instance, by varying the carbon content or adding chromium, nickel, or molybdenum. 

TesT testing machines thus provide the foundation for innovation, safety, and progress in research and industrial development.
